JOB OVERVIEW
As a Banquet Captain you play an important role to the overall success of events. You will be overseeing all staff during each event and one of their main contact people along with the Director of Banquets. You will prepare and execute banquet activities with a goal of ensuring that guests have a favorable event experience. You will report directly to the Director of Banquets and help supervise Banquet Set-Up, Banquet Servers, and Banquet Bartenders.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
  • Assist with setup of the banquet area. This includes but is not limited to table setup, buffet setup, beverage setup, décor, and more.
  • Lead your team by example
  • Have a “can do” attitude
  • Responsible for a clean and presentable service of food
  • Serve food and beverages to guests
  • Take guests food and beverage orders in a timely matter
  • Relay food orders to the Banquet Chef
  • Clearing of empty plates, glasses, and silverware throughout the event
  • Respond to all requests and concerns in a timely and professional manner.
  • Be creative and flexible with meeting special requests.
  • Note changes or additions to banquet event orders and report them to the Director of Banquets
  • Maintain order and cleanliness in storage areas including securing A/V equipment.
  • Thrive in a fast-paced environment and handle last-minute client needs with ease.
  • Support the goals of Pelican Lakes through teamwork and collaboration with all departments
  • Troubleshoot problems with ease, such as wind, rain, electrical issues, boat issues, etc.
  • Willing to work long hours and be the driving force of your team
  • You will be in direct communication with the Director of Banquets and the Banquet Chef
  • Able to remain calm in stressful situations
  • Guide your staff and make cuts accordingly
  • Drive the golf cart & trailer
  • Assist with post event cleanup, inventory, food storage and tear down
